The European medical devices trade association, EUCOMED, has been accepted as an associate member of the European Standards Committee, CEN, the body responsible for drafting European standards. EUCOMED now has the right to become involved in all aspects of CEN work and will therefore have a greater influence on standards work. Only five industry associations across all sectors are associate members of CEN. Richard Moore, now a senior EUCOMED executive, worked at CEN for some six years until 1997 - he was responsible for co-ordinating standardisation projects in healthcare and the environment.
